Obituary

Charles “Ed” Clarke, age 76 of Litchfield Park, AZ died November 26, 2017 from complications of Parkinson’s Disease Dementia as a result of exposure to Agent Orange in Vietnam. He was born December 1, 1940 in Jackson, MS to Cyrus Augustus and Louise Smith Clarke. He served in the US Air Force from 1963 – 1983 as a fighter pilot achieving the rank of Lt. Colonel. After his discharge from the US Air Force, Ed worked as a manager at Tres Realty in Goodyear for another 20 years. He was a gifted instructor and loved sharing his knowledge and experience with his students. He also was a talented musician, drummer, artist and woodworker.

Ed is survived by his wife of 50 years, Heather Clarke; sons, Tim and Dan Clarke; five grandchildren, Anthony, Misti, Vivian, Jesse and Simon Clarke and one great grandchild, Chloe Clarke.
